Abstract

Disclosed is an antibacterial cleaner composition for a toilet seat, which is effective against both viruses and bacteria. Also disclosed is an antibacterial cleaning material comprising the antibacterial cleaner composition. Further disclosed is an antibacterial cleaning method using the antibacterial cleaner composition or the antibacterial cleaner material. The antibacterial cleaner composition for a toilet seat contains the following components (A) to (C) in the following amounts all relative to the total amount of the composition: (A) a lower alcohol in an amount of 35 to 75 mass%; (B) (b1) an organic acid and an alkali metal salt thereof and/or (b2) an inorganic acid and an alkali metal salt thereof in the total amount of 0.05 to 10 mass%; and (C) at least one nonionic surfactant selected from a monoglycerin fatty acid ester, a polyglycerin fatty acid ester, a sorbitan fatty acid ester, a polyoxyethylene sorbitan fatty acid ester and a sucrose fatty acid ester in an amount of 0.05 to 5 mass%. The antibacterial cleaner composition further contains water as an additional component (D). A stock solution of the composition has a pH value ranging from 8 to 12 at 25 DEG C (as measured by the 'pH measurement method' in accordance with JIS Z-8802:1984).

Background technology
In recent years, the increase of the food poisoning that causes of norovirus (Norovirus) becomes a kind of problem.2006 (putting down into 18 years) frequency, patient's number all in the incidence of the food poisoning that causes of norovirus the highest; Its frequency is about 500 times, and its patient's number is very many, promptly is about 27600 people; Because large-scale food poisoning takes place in its communicable intensity in succession.In addition; Reason that it is generally acknowledged the food poisoning that norovirus causes is musselss such as edible oyster; But know that recently secondary pollution is its major cause, this secondary pollution is the norovirus that contains of food, ight soil, vomitus through contact the secondary pollution that clean surface etc. is propagated at the interpersonal food that infects and pollute or water.
When infecting norovirus, in ight soil or vomitus, there is the norovirus of a great deal of.In the lavatory, vomit, perhaps drain when suffering from diarrhoea thing, its major part flows to purification tank, but its a part of and a large amount of norovirus together are attached to toilet device and lavatory seat.In addition,,, also be attached to finger in a large number so pass toilet paper because norovirus is less, first-class with the fire hose of the running water pipe of door handle that holds the lavatory that has adhered to norovirus or wash stand, the range extension of the pollution of norovirus.In order to prevent these, much less going will wash one's hands completely behind the lavatory and effectively removing is attached to the lavatory seat in lavatory or the virus of door handle is to prevent to become important aspect the secondary pollution.
In addition, be called norwalk virus (Norwalk virus) or coccoid virus (Small round structured virus) before " norovirus ", but international virusology can determine to belong to into the norovirus of Caliciviridae.That is, norovirus is the RAN C-type virus C that only has RNA, utilize the protein shell be called capsid cover RNA around, do not have the film that constitutes by sugar and lipid that is called coating.
The virus that generally has coating is destroyed coating simply through medicine, can not with the receptors bind of host cell, so can deactivation.But norovirus does not have this coating, therefore has the resistivity to medicine.
As the ablation method of norovirus, known use chlorine bleach liquor's method; Or the method for disinfection with hot water (referring to non-patent literature 1).But; In disinfection with hot water, preferably keep the temperature more than 85 ℃; But when watering hot water, reduce, be difficult to the temperature that keeps desired with the temperature that contacts that is sterilized thing to being sterilized thing; Perhaps the danger of the scald when the influence that is sterilized the thing material, operation waits, and becomes the insufficient method of a kind of operation property.
In addition, utilize in chlorine bleach liquor's the sterilization method, being sterilized thing is under the situation of metallic hard surface or plastics crust, produces rust, deterioration and corrosion etc. sometimes.And have following problem: according to being sterilized thing, the bleaching action of Youxiaolin, effect cause decolouring.In addition, the problem that exists the smell of Youxiaolin in the lavatory etc. to spread is if under the situation about perhaps share with acid lotion etc. with the lavatory by error, the chlorine that toxigenicity is high is under the worst situation even also might death.
For this reason, usually in the degerming of the lavatory seat in lavatory etc. is cleaned, use with the degerming clean-out system of alcohol as principal constituent.
Known, alcohol is for the inactivating efficacy not enough (referring to non-patent literature 2 and 3) of the replacement virus feline calicivirus F9 strain of norovirus.Need to prove; The present situation of norovirus is because to culturing cell or not success of zooperal infection; So feline calicivirus F9 strain is as replacing virus in the norovirus test method(s) of American National EPA (EPA); Under situation such as antivirus test or experiment, in Japan with the external replacement virus of using feline calicivirus as norovirus.

(1) to the deactivation power of virus
[TP] has a try the various confessions of 270 μ L after the feline calicivirus F9 strain (FCV) of stoste and 30 μ L of agent contacts 60 seconds, and (α-MEM) (make) 10 times of dilutions with the pure medicine of light society, further serial dilution is 10 times with α-Minimum Essential Medium.In the cat kidney cell of on 96 hole microwell plates, cultivating in advance (CRFK), add α-MEM of 50 μ L, add the liquid of serial dilution in advance at this.At 37 ℃, 5%CO 2Exist down and cultivated 4 days, whether confirm cytopathy.Use ultrapure water to do the blank agent that replaces supplying to have a try, calculate the various confessions FCV LogReduction that agent causes that has a try, estimate with following determinating reference from these differences.
[determinating reference]
◎: LogReduction is more than 4
Zero: LogReduction is more than 3, below 4
*: LogReduction is below 3
Need to prove, ◎ and zero is judged as situation with practicality.
(2) to the sterilizing power of bacterium
[TP] carries out according to sanitising agent (sanitizer) test method(s) of chemurgy scholar association of official (AOAC).At length say, in the stoste of agent is had a try in the various confessions of 9.9ml, add to become 10 in Nutrient Broth (NB) substratum (manufacturing of MERCK society) 8~10 9The bacterium liquid of the 0.1ml that the mode of individual bacterium number is adjusted.Contact after 30 seconds, the adding that its 1ml is joined 9ml has in the phosphoric acid buffer of inactivator, carries out serial dilution thereafter immediately.With plate count agar (PCA) substratum (manufacturing of MERCK society) mixed diluting, measure existence bacterium number after 48 hours 37 ℃ of cultivations.Calculate LogReduction from the logarithmic difference of inoculation bacterium number and existence bacterium number, estimate with following determinating reference.Need to prove,, use intestinal bacteria (Escherichiacoli IFO-12734) and staphylococcus aureus (Staphylococus aureusIFO-12732) as supplying the examination bacterium.
[determinating reference]
Zero: LogReduction is more than 5
*: LogReduction is below 5
